There is a huge amount of population based in China are living in Australia in order to
cure the type 2 form of diabetes. In Australia as Chinese people do not understand the language
properly which causes them a huge issue related to the language. IN the medication process it is
important that doctors and the patient communicate with each other properly. Communication
allow the patient to clearly discuss the issue they are facing and the challenges that are
addressing (Debussche and et.al., 2021). Interaction between doctors and the patient play a vital
role in addressing to the respective issue. People also found that the diabetes services provided in
the Australia is not effective enough. Patient faced many issues related to the communication
with doctors, lack of proper knowledge of doctors in the country to cure the respective disease.
There is a hug amount of population of Chinese who are living in the Australia and suffering
from the type 2 form of diabetes. Many times Chinese people do not feel comfortable with the
practices adopted by the professionals and doctors based in Australia to cure the diabetes (Etando
and et.al., 2021). People who are belonging to the collectivist oriented societies place a grater
emphasis on inter dependence within the families. Social connectivity and perception of the
people put a great impact on the treatment process adopted (Knight-Agarwal And et.al., 2021).
The study celery reflected the fact that it is essential to establishes proper and positive
relationship between stakeholders so that better amount of treatment and cure process can be
applied by the doctors and medical professionals.
